Maybe so, but my company has been using pickle as a primary long-term storage mechanism for more than a decade. We only rarely have problems with code changes causing pickle problems (less than once per year). OTOH, we mostly only have a growing internal format -- we almost never change the internal format.
And then tons of companies are using ZODB wich uses pickle... so no biggie... but using pickle directly can be a problem if you have lots of data. -- Leonardo Santagada
